Majority would back Scottish independence if Johnson becomes PM, poll suggests


More than half of Scottish voters would vote to leave the UK if Boris Johnson becomes prime minister, a new poll suggests. However, when asked how they would vote if Johnson were to become prime minister, 53% say they would back independence, with 47% against it. The poll found that Johnson has a personal approval rating of minus 37 north of the border, behind his leadership rival Jeremy Hunt, who shares an approval rating of minus 24 with Brexit Party leader Nigel Farage. First Minister Nicola Sturgeon’s rating is neutral while Scottish Conservative leader Ruth Davidson is on minus one. Labour leader Jeremy Corbyn’s approval rating is minus 44 in Scotland.
